Reasons Why You Need To Have a Business Telephone System.
The first reason why you should own a business telephone system is to share phone lines. To share a phone line in an environment where there is no phone system so that an employee can access a specific phone line, the line would go through termination on that individual’s phone. In case a company wants to have a different phone number for each worker, they will need to jack installed for each worker and have one phone line. Through the utilization of a phone system, workers can share a phone line.
The system offers entry to every phone and line assigns and set a separate extension for each staff.
The other advantage of having a firm telephone system is abbreviating dialing. In a surrounding where there is no phone system, workers are fond of communicating with other workers using sneaker nets or shouts. Meaning if one staff needs to talk to another, that individual will be forced to move over to another individuals desk or must shout. Being in a phone system surrounding will enable the workers to communicate with ease by simply picking up a receiver and dial three to four digits to reach the other worker.
The other benefit that comes with owning a business telephone system is that there will be an auto attendant. If you have ever found yourself in a situation where you called a firm and heard a recorded direction to dial by name and enter an extension, then that was an auto attendant that you were listening to. When it comes to several businesses, an auto-attendant is an efficient replacement of a receptionist. The other advantage the comes with having a business phone system is that it may help in the elimination of phone company monthly reoccurring costs. If your firm is making use of one or two-line sets from a local staple and you wish to have voice messaging, you must pay a monthly charge of each voice messaging box. A tiny business with five phones and workers could pay one hundred dollars with ease in a month for voice messaging from a phone organization within the area. The similar functionality can emerge from a firm phone system, doing away with the monthly expense.
The other advantage of having a business telephone system is to eliminate or save on expenses related to conference calls.
For a tiny incremented cost a conference bridge can be bought by the use of a company phone system. Three way making a call typically can cost less than $5 monthly per phone line. Moreover, the expense can be adding up if a company has numerous phone lines and conferencing limitation is up to three participants.
